The Simple Math: Calculating Age in Years 💡
  • Current Year - Birth Year = Nominal Age
    is the foundation of every age calculation, offering a quick, less precise estimate.
  • Your chronological age is the time elapsed since your birth, often expressed in years, months, and days, which is the most common user search intent.
  • To find your exact age in years, subtract the year of birth from the current year, then adjust downward by one if your birthday hasn't occurred yet in the current calendar year.
  • A fun trick: If you add the year you were born to your current age, the sum will always equal the current calendar year, a simple check for quick mental math.
  • Why do digital calculators need a full date (DOB)? Because relying only on the year ignores the critical factor of whether the current date has passed the birth date within the current year.
  • Biological age, often searched by health enthusiasts, is different from chronological age and is estimated by biomarkers, not simple date subtraction.

The Leap Year Conundrum in Age Calculation 🌍
  • The leap year (366 days) is the single most common cause of error in manually calculating age in days, as it occurs every four years.
  • A year is a leap year if it is divisible by 4, unless it is divisible by 100 but not by 400 (e.g., 2000 was a leap year, but 1900 was not).
  • For individuals born on February 29th, their technical birthday only occurs every four years, leading to unique queries like "How often does a Leap Year baby age?"
  • (Year % 4 == 0) && (Year % 100 != 0 || Year % 400 == 0)
    is the programming logic required to correctly identify and account for the extra day in age calculation.
  • When a February 29th baby celebrates a birthday in a non-leap year, they typically celebrate on either February 28th or March 1st, a cultural choice that affects legal age recognition.
  • The concept of the 'Intercalary day' (February 29th) ensures that the calendar year remains synchronized with the Earth's orbit around the Sun, preventing seasonal drift.

  • Historical note: Julius Caesar introduced the original concept of the leap year, and the Gregorian calendar refined it to the current rule, influencing all modern age calculations.
  • The difference between the Julian calendar (simpler leap rule) and the Gregorian calendar (complex leap rule) is a major factor in calculating ages from centuries ago.
  • Short trick for leap year counting: To estimate the number of leap days between two dates, divide the number of intervening years by 4, then adjust based on the 100/400 rule.
